PEC Pelican Seaplane Base
Pelican, Alaska, USA


FAA INFORMATION EFFECTIVE 19 FEBRUARY 2026

Location

FAA Identifier: PEC
Lat/Long: 57-57-18.6200N 136-14-10.5840W
57-57.310333N 136-14.176400W
57.9551722,-136.2362733
(estimated)
Elevation: 0 ft. / 0 m (estimated)
Variation: 27E (1985)
Time zone: UTC -9 (UTC -8 during Daylight Saving Time)

Seaplane Base Operations

Seaplane Base use: Open to the public
Activation date: 12/1952
Control tower: no
ARTCC: ANCHORAGE CENTER
FSS: JUNEAU FLIGHT SERVICE STATION [907-586-7380]
NOTAMs facility: JNU (NOTAM-D service available)
Attendance: UNATNDD
Wind indicator: no
Segmented circle: no

Seaplane Base Communications

CTAF: 122.9

Runway Information

Runway NW/SE

Dimensions: 10000 x 2000 ft. / 3048 x 610 m
Surface: water, in excellent condition
RUNWAY NW  RUNWAY SE
Elevation: 0.0 ft.0.0 ft.
Traffic pattern: leftleft

Additional Remarks

OPRG AREA IN LISTANSKI INLET; SUBJECT TO STRONG NW & SE WINDS.
BOATS MAY BE TIED TO SPB DOCK/FLOAT RAMP.
BOATS ACTIVE IN HARBOR DURG SUMMER.
WX CAMERA AVBL ON INTERNET AT HTTPS://WEATHERCAMS.FAA.GOV
